Ler em inglês

Partilhar via


Bh1745 Classe

Definição

Sensor de cor digital Bh1745.

C#
public class Bh1745 : IDisposable
C#
[System.Device.Model.Interface("Digital color sensor Bh1745.")]
public class Bh1745 : IDisposable
Herança
Bh1745
Atributos
Implementações

Construtores

Bh1745(I2cDevice)

Sensor de cor digital Bh1745.

Campos

DefaultI2cAddress

O endereço I2c primário do BH1745

SecondaryI2cAddress

O endereço I2c secundário do BH1745

Propriedades

AdcGain

Obtém ou define o ganho adc do sensor.

ChannelCompensationMultipliers

Obtém ou define os multiplicadores de compensação de canal que são usados para compensar as medidas.

HigherInterruptThreshold

Obtém ou define o limite de interrupção mais alto.

InterruptIsEnabled

Obtém ou define se o pino de interrupção está habilitado.

InterruptPersistence

Obtém ou define a função de persistência da interrupção.

InterruptReset

Obtém ou define o estado do pino de interrupção.

InterruptSignalIsActive

Obtém se o sinal de interrupção está ativo.

InterruptSource

Obtém ou define o canal de origem da interrupção.

LatchBehavior

Obtém ou define como o pino de interrupção trava.

LowerInterruptThreshold

Obtém ou define o limite de interrupção inferior.

MeasurementIsActive

Obtém ou define se a medida está ativa.

MeasurementTime

Obtém ou define o tempo de medição definido no momento.

Métodos

Dispose()

Descarta os recursos Bh1745.

GetCompensatedColor()

Obtém a leitura de cor compensada do sensor.

ReadBlueDataRegister()

Lê o registro de dados azul do sensor.

ReadClearDataRegister()

Lê o registro de dados claros do sensor.

ReadGreenDataRegister()

Lê o registro de dados verdes do sensor.

ReadMeasurementIsValid()

Lê se a última medida é válida.

ReadRedDataRegister()

Lê o registro de dados vermelho do sensor.

Reset()

Redefine o dispositivo para a configuração padrão. Ao redefinir, o sensor vai para o modo de desligar.

Métodos de Extensão

MeasurementTimeAsTimeSpan(Bh1745)

Converte o tempo de medição de enumeração em um TimeSpan.

Aplica-se a

Produto Versões
.NET IoT Libraries 1.1.0, 1.2.0, 1.3.0, 1.4.0, 1.5.0, 2.0.0, 2.1.0, 2.2.0